Output 14593ccab1a031d6a60069affce3073fa9d2e16521661a617ec4e99b70579884:0

value
2609406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bd26acd14d422cc35e7f42ced694932e13ed982 OP_EQUAL
address
3LGjAXarUKWHiSqQHiMwtEvwEB6EGmGURZ
transaction
14593ccab1a031d6a60069affce3073fa9d2e16521661a617ec4e99b70579884
spent
true